| 1 | Then Job answered: | Job. Jb.12.1-14.22 | |
| 2 | "No doubt you are the people,  and wisdom will die with you.  | ||
| 3 | But I have understanding as well as you;  I am not inferior to you. Who does not know such things as these?  | ||
| 4 | I am a laughingstock to my friends;  I, who called upon God and he answered me, a just and blameless man, am a laughingstock.  | ||
| 5 | In the thought of one who is at ease there is contempt for misfortune; it is ready for those whose feet slip.  | ||
| 6 | The tents of robbers are at peace,  and those who provoke God are secure, who bring their god in their hand.  | ||
| 7 | "But ask the beasts, and they will teach you; the birds of the air, and they will tell you;  | ||
| 8 | or the plants of the earth, and they will teach you;  and the fish of the sea will declare to you.  | ||
| 9 | Who among all these does not know that the hand of Yahweh has done this? | ||
| 10 | In his hand is the life of every living thing  and the breath of all mankind.  | ||
| 11 | Does not the ear search words  as the palate tastes food?  | ||
| 12 | Wisdom is with the aged,  and understanding in length of days.  | ||
| 13 | "With God are wisdom and might;  he has counsel and understanding.  | ||
| 14 | If he tears down, none can rebuild; if he shuts a man in, none can open.  | ||
| 15 | If he withholds the waters, they dry up; if he sends them out, they overwhelm the land.  | ||
| 16 | With him are strength and wisdom; the deceived and the deceiver are his.  | ||
| 17 | He leads counselors away stripped, and judges he makes fools.  | ||
| 18 | He looses the bonds of kings,  and binds a waistcloth on their loins.  | ||
| 19 | He leads priests away stripped,  and overthrows the mighty.  | ||
| 20 | He deprives of speech those who are trusted,  and takes away the discernment of the elders.  | ||
| 21 | He pours contempt on princes,  and looses the belt of the strong.  | ||
| 22 | He uncovers the deeps out of darkness,  and brings deep darkness to light.  | ||
| 23 | He makes nations great, and he destroys them:  he enlarges nations, and leads them away.  | ||
| 24 | He takes away understanding from the chiefs of the people of the earth,  and makes them wander in a pathless waste.  | ||
| 25 | They grope in the dark without light;  and he makes them stagger like a drunken man.  | ||
